Teal, Pink, And Yellow Delight
About This Color Palette
<Teal, Pink, and Yellow Delight>
1. Deep Teal -
#007C7F
- A rich teal that provides a strong foundation and a sense of tranquility.
2. Soft Teal -
#2ED9D7
- A lighter, cheerful teal that adds vibrancy and freshness to the palette.
3. Coral Pink -
#FF6F61
- A lively coral pink that injects energy and warmth, making it inviting.
4. Blush Pink -
#FFB3BA
- A soft, pastel pink that brings a gentle touch and balances the bold colors.
5. Lemon Yellow -
#FFEA00
- A bright, sunny yellow that adds a pop of cheerfulness and optimism.
6. Golden Yellow -
#FFD700
- A warm gold that complements the yellow tones while providing depth.
7. Light Grey -
#E0E0E0
- A neutral light grey that allows the brighter colors to stand out without distraction.
This vibrant palette combines varying shades of teal, pink, and yellow, creating an energetic and playful look while maintaining harmony. The inclusion of light grey serves to ground the palette, ensuring that the brighter shades remain balanced and aesthetically pleasing.

Understanding WCAG Scores
Normal Text
- AA requires 4.5:1 ratio
- AAA requires 7.0:1 ratio
Large Text (18pt+ or 14pt+ bold)
- AA requires 3.0:1 ratio
- AAA requires 4.5:1 ratio
